How Much Is the Global Fibrate Drugs Market Valued at Present and by 2029?

The market size for fibrate drugs has been experiencing constant growth over the past few years. The market is projected to increase from $3.49 billion in 2024 to $3.58 billion in 2025,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.8%. The historical growth has been influenced by factors such as focus on lipid and cholesterol management, extensive clinical research and trials, reduction in cardiovascular risks, and the use of combination therapies.

The market size of fibrates drugs is projected to witness robust growth in the coming years, swelling to “$4.72 billion in 2029 with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.2%.” This projected growth during the forecast period can be credited to ongoing updates in treatment protocols, an emphasis on residual risk, advancements in precision medicine, and innovation in drug distribution methods. Key future trends include the exploration of alternative drug formulations, the integration of telemedicine, the use of fibrates in high-risk groups, efforts to target triglyceride levels, and an enhanced focus on increasing HDL levels.

#What Drivers Are Influencing Growth In The Fibrate Drugs Market?

The escalating occurrences of cardiac diseases are anticipated to fuel the progression of the fibrate drug market. Cardiac diseases comprise a variety of conditions that impact the heart and blood vessels, including congenital heart disease, coronary heart disease, and more. Fibrates act as a preventative measure against further heart attacks and strokes in individuals who already have a circulatory system condition, which contributes to the advancement of the fibrate drug market. For example, the Singapore Heart Foundation (SHF) reported that ischemic heart diseases caused 5,302 deaths in May 2024, a minor increase from 5,290 deaths in 2022. Moreover, the overall death rate due to hypertensive diseases rose to 3.7% in 2022 from 3.4% the previous year. Consequently, the rising prevalence of cardiac diseases is propelling the fibrate drug market’s expansion.

What Future Market Trends Are Projected For The Fibrate Drugs Industry?

Major players in the fibrate drugs market are concentrating their efforts on the advancement of new solutions like fixed-dose combinations to retain their market dominance. A fixed-dose combination is defined as a single dose formulation containing more than one active ingredient, which simplifies the administration process and potentially enhances the therapeutic results. For example, in May 2023, Intercept Pharmaceuticals Inc., a US-based biopharmaceutical company, earned the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approval for an orphan drug designation for the fixed-dose combination of obeticholic acid (OCA) and bezafibrate. The combination, which is a pe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or (PPAR) agonist, is under investigation for the potential treatment of individuals with primary biliary cholangitis (PBC). OCA, a farnesoid X receptor (FXR) agonist, is currently being marketed as Ocaliva by Intercept in the United States for PBC treatment, whereas bezafibrate, a pan-PPAR agonist, does not have approval in the United States for any indication at present.
